* A scoring opportunity occurs when an offense gets a first down inside the opponent's 40 (or scores from outside the 40).
** Leverage Rate = Standard Downs / (Standard Downs + Passing Downs)
*** When using IsoPPP, the S&P formula is (0.8*Success Rate) + (0.2*IsoPPP)

Man oh man, what a charge by SDSU this year. The Aztecs were 1-3 at the end of September with a loss to South Alabama. Since then: nine wins in a row with only one (this one) coming by fewer than 14 points. The offense still isn't very good, but the defense is one of the best in the mid-major universe, and Air Force was the first team since September to score more than 17 points on the Aztecs. Air Force also acquitted itself well here, but the Aztecs were the best, most consistent team in MWC play this year. They are a deserving conference champion.
